Join the Gulf Coast Symphony from Dec. 3 – 18 for Snowbird Follies The Musical at the Music & Arts Community Center in Fort Myers.
Nomads from the North have been flocking to the sunshine state for well over 100 years. Come enjoy a whimsical musical yuletide celebration with a winking nod to Fort Myers’ original snowbirds, Thomas Edison and Henry Ford.
From “Boogie Woogie Santa Claus” to “White Christmas,” this revue is a playful journey through decades of holiday favorites, sprinkled with local history.
This brand new musical revue has been conceived and created by renowned director and writer DJ Salisbury and Gulf Coast Symphony Maestro Andrew Kurtz, with arrangements created by Julie Carver.
